"Hearst Magazines and Yahoo may earn commission or revenue on some items through these links." Sous vide machines first gained popularity among professional restaurant chefs thanks to their precise, ...
Sous vide literally means “under vacuum” in French. However, in the kitchen, it basically means the process of making super tender and juicy food. It’s a method of cooking by vacuum sealing and ...